Deprivation Index

The Index of Multiple Deprivation (IMD) is a UK measure that ranks areas based on multiple indicators of deprivation such as income, employment, health, education, housing, crime, and access to services. The IMD informs decisions and helps allocate resources to reduce poverty and improve life chances.

Created with Raphaël 2.1.28546.00LOW132844

The lower the score (out of 32844 in England), the more deprived the postcode.
